# Break-Glass: Catalog Cache Invalidation

Scope: the Pinrow product catalog at Veldstone Retail. If stale prices persist after a purge and the Hollowmere invalidation queue is wedged, use break-glass to flush the edge tier directly. Contractors: get verbal sign-off from the catalog lead first. Steps: open the Hollowmere admin shell, select emergency-flush, confirm the tenant, and run it once — repeated flushes thrash the origin. Access is logged and expires after 20 minutes. Unseal the admin shell with the passphrase below.

recovery phrase for kahop-tajog: istix-casvan

MEMO — Branch Managers, Korval Supplies

The Threnn Logistics contract renews on the first of next month. Rates hold for twelve months; fuel surcharge cap drops two points. Delivery windows tighten to four hours — adjust branch scheduling accordingly. Report service failures within 48 hours or penalties lapse. Do not negotiate side arrangements locally; all variations route through procurement in Halbrook. Noncompliance affects the group rebate. Questions go to the contracts desk. Strategic background is provided immediately below.

management briefing: The renewal with Zoraelax Group closes at $10 million a year, 15 percent below the last contract. Project Ralael slips by six weeks because of the audit delay.

**Key ceremony checklist — item 7 of 12 (StockRoute planner)**

Okay, this is the step reviewers usually flag, so read carefully. Before generating the new signing key for the StockRoute restock-planner fleet, confirm both witnesses from the Dellfort office are physically present and the old key has been marked retired in the ledger. Then, and only then, open the escrow envelope. As the security reviewer, you verify the escrow contents match the recorded phrase. For the record, that recovery passphrase appears on the line below.

unlock words, fafop-hawep: briwyn-oliix-sorox